Beware of Scams

Owning and running your own Internet business is a dream for many would-be entrepreneurs. If you're looking for an Internet startup, be careful not to fall prey to the many scams out there offering to send you a list of home business ideas via the Internet. These scams often cost at least $50 of your hard-earned money and in return they promise to send you a free ebook that promises to tell you everything you need to know to get started. These promises are often accompanied by a website filled with photos of luxury cars, people living lavish lifestyles, and fabricated testimonials from people telling how they were able to get rich fast. Before you even think of signing up for something like this, ask yourself why a free ebook should cost you anything. If free information costs something, then it is best to steer clear of the offer.

Benefits of an Internet Startup

Starting a home-based Internet business offers a number of benefits. First of all, it requires less cash and effort to get things started than a brick and mortar business. Another benefit is that while an Internet startup poses less financial risk on the front end, it still has the potential to grow into a profitable business. Along with these types of benefits you can also enjoy perks like staying at home: money saved on a business wardrobe, gas to and from the office, and a flexible work schedule.

Meet a Need

To be successful, your startup Internet business should meet a need. This makes the people who have the need your potential customers. If you take a look around, it won't take long to see needs that hold potential for a future business. For instance, if you saw a talk show featuring plus size women bemoaning the lack of appropriate business attire for women of size, with the right contacts, affiliates and website you could meet that need and grow a thriving Internet business. Needs fall into two categories. They are either a product or service.

Product Driven Internet Business

Ideas for meeting needs are as endless as your imagination. Think about solutions to problems you've come up with over the years. How do you open that pickle jar? How do you cut your brownies into perfect squares? Ideas such as these are the fodder for starting a successful business.

One Internet tool available to a product-driven online business is an eBay store. Opening an eBay store is like being part of a virtual mall. The process is fairly easy and the cost for a basic store is just $15.95 a month. An eBay store is just one option to display your virtual wares. Such tools are used in conjunction with your company's website. You can advertise it in the signature line of your emails, tweet about it on Twitter, blog about it and talk about it on Facebook.

Service or Information Oriented Business

Along with products, services and information can also be the basis for an online startup business. If you have expertise, you can put it to work by offering ebooks, online coaching, webinars, etc. People pay for the right information; solutions they are looking for to help solve a problem or save or make them money. Expertise can cover everything from the boardroom to the bedroom. Here are a few popular venues:

  • Offering specialized management training
  • The "how to" of social media to increase your earnings
  • How to start a business
  • Party planner: How to plan a party and save money
  • Wedding planner: How to have the wedding of your dreams on a budget
  • Writing coach: How to earn a living as a writer.
  • Budgeting: This can cover everything from making meals on a shoestring to learning to live on one income.
  • Real Estate: How to navigate real estate investing in the current housing market.

This is a small sample of possible services that could be turned into successful online business ventures. They all meet a need and in some way the need to save or make money.

Get Started

Once you have a basic plan for your internet startup business, you'll find an online business doesn't require the same extensive planning as a brick and mortar business. In fact, if you take too long, someone else may pop up on the Internet with your idea. Once you have the idea, move forward and build your website. The Internet offers valuable feedback through analytics, number of sales and user comments that can help you tweak your business to meet the needs of your customers. If you come across the right product or service, your idea may easily become a top Internet startup business within a short amount of time.
